O.C.G.A. § 50-8-99 (2019)
Acceptance and expenditure of gifts, loans, and grants

In carrying out the purposes of this article, a commission shall be authorized to contract with, apply for, and accept gifts, loans, and grants from federal, state, or local governments, public agencies, semipublic agencies, or private agencies, to expend such funds, and to carry out cooperative undertakings or contracts with any such government or agency.
History
Code 1981, § 50-8-99, enacted by Ga. L.
1982, p. 2107, § 51; Ga. L. 1983, p. 3, § 39.
